Brake light switch Question

Does the brake light switch control more than just the brake light?

I removed my switch after it died and tried driving the car without it to go get a new one....but when I tried to stop/slow down, the brake pedal pressed all the way to the floor and I had to pump it a few times to get any braking power. It felt just like a master cylinder gone bad.

I figured it was okay to drive, thinking that the switch only operates the actual light, but is this a function of the switch that will be corrected once the new one is installed?

Well, after I put in the new brake switch, all was good. Brake light worked, was able to shift out of park, and no problems with the brakes on a test drive.
